WebThe codim 1 bifurcation associated to the critical case (a) is called a fold (or limit point) bifurcation of maps. The codim 1 bifurcation occuring at the critical case (b) is called a flip (or period-doubling) bifurcation, while the codim 1 bifurcation related to case (c) is referred to as a Neimark-Sacker bifurcation. WebIf the eigenvalue is equal to one, the bifurcation is either a saddle-node (often called fold bifurcation in maps), transcritical or pitchfork bifurcation. If the eigenvalue is equal to −1, it is a period-doubling (or flip) bifurcation, …
WebJan 1, 2004 · The fold-flip bifurcation occurs if a map has a fixed point with multipliers +1 and -1 simultaneously. In this paper the normal form of this singularity is calculated explicitly.
